How Common Is The Last Name Kjelsberg?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 948,111th most prevalent family name internationally, borne by approximately 1 in 26,404,152 people. The surname Kjelsberg occurs mostly in Europe, where 90 percent of Kjelsberg are found; 85 percent are found in Northern Europe and 85 percent are found in Scandinavia.

The surname is most prevalent in Norway, where it is carried by 227 people, or 1 in 22,653. In Norway it is most numerous in: Eastern Norway, where 52 percent are found, Central Norway, where 31 percent are found and Northern Norway, where 15 percent are found. Excluding Norway Kjelsberg exists in 8 countries. It also occurs in The United States, where 9 percent are found and Switzerland, where 5 percent are found.
